Scallion PancakeScallion pancake is a traditional Chinese pastry made primarily from flour and flavored with chopped scallions. To prepare it, the dough is rolled into a thin sheet, sprinkled with scallions, salt, and oil, then rolled up, flattened into a pancake shape, and pan-fried until golden and crispy. The scallion pancake has a crispy exterior and tender interior with a fragrant onion aroma—it can be enjoyed as breakfast or as a tea-time snack.

Soy Sauce BeefSteamed beef is a delicious dish made primarily from beef, which absorbs the sauce thoroughly through marinating and slow stewing. During preparation, the beef is first marinated, then slowly cooked in a specially prepared sauce until fully tender, and finally cooled before being sliced and served.
Shiitake Braised Pork RiceXianggu Lu Rou Fan is a classic dish made primarily with pork belly, mushrooms, and rice. The pork belly is cut into small cubes and simmered together with mushrooms in a specially prepared braising sauce until the meat becomes tender and the mushrooms absorb the rich flavors. Finally, the braised pork and mushrooms with the sauce are poured over steaming hot rice for a delicious meal.
